Double Sided Tape Market, Segmentation by Resin Type
Segmentation by resin type highlights differences in adhesion performance, temperature tolerance, and substrate compatibility across industries. Manufacturers innovate with durability, shear strength, and climate resistance to meet demanding bonding requirements in automotive and construction applications. Sustainability and low-VOC chemistries are becoming important purchasing criteria, especially in regulated markets.
Acrylic
Acrylic resin tapes deliver long-term bonding with strong UV resistance and durability in varied temperatures. Their balance of shear and peel strength makes them ideal for automotive trims, signage, and consumer electronics assembly. Increased adoption aligns with long-life advanced materials where structural bonding replaces rivets and fasteners.
Rubber
Rubber-based tapes provide strong initial tack and bonding to rough or low-energy surfaces at cost-effective price points. They suit indoor applications such as paper, packaging, and general industrial uses where climate exposure is limited. Vendors improve aging stability and solvent resistance to support wider adoption among mid-tier manufacturers.
Silicone
Silicone tapes offer exceptional temperature resistance and adhesion to difficult substrates like silicone rubbers and fluoropolymers. Their role is expanding in aerospace, electronics, and high-performance industrial settings. Though premium priced, their thermal cycling durability supports mission-critical assemblies with stringent reliability demands.
Others
Other chemistries including hybrid adhesives target niche solutions balancing tack, solvent resistance, and price. These formulations serve emerging needs in wearables, mobility devices, and flexible substrates. Partnerships among converters and adhesive innovators support rapid commercialization of new grades.
Double Sided Tape Market, Segmentation by Technology
The coating and processing technology determines adhesive performance, emissions profile, and regulatory compatibility. Buyers evaluate drying efficiency, curing behavior, and end-product consistency to ensure high-quality bonds across diverse application conditions. Innovations center on eco-friendly processes and thermal efficiency enhancements to reduce production costs and emissions.
Solvent-Based
Solvent-based systems deliver high-quality adhesion and reliable performance on complex substrates. They remain favored in applications requiring chemical and moisture resistance. Compliance with VOC regulations drives investment in recovery systems and greener solvent choices to sustain adoption.
Water-Based
Water-based technology supports low-VOC and environmentally friendly objectives vital for automotive interiors and construction. It provides safer workplace handling and strong bonds on porous materials. Vendors improve drying speeds and moisture resistance to strengthen competitiveness with solvent-based systems.
Hot-Melt-Based
Hot-melt tapes enable rapid bonding, automation compatibility, and clean application without solvents. The format excels in packaging, appliances, and electronics where fast throughput is critical. Developments in temperature resistance and hybrid resins expand usage into more demanding structural purposes.
Double Sided Tape Market, Segmentation by Tape-Backing Material
Tape-backing materials determine conformability, strength, and surface protection, shaping end-use fit and life-cycle performance. Manufacturers tailor backings to unique texture, vibration, and stress environments across mobility and industrial sectors. Sustainability shifts encourage lightweight composites and recycling-friendly choices.
Foam-Backed
Foam backings provide gap filling, vibration damping, and thermal expansion tolerance. They replace mechanical fasteners in automotive and appliances where clean aesthetics are vital. Weather resistance supports exterior trim bonding and signage applications in varied climates.
Film-Backed
Film-backed tapes enhance precision and strength in electronics, displays, and industrial laminations. Thin profiles and die-cut flexibility allow micro-assembly and portable device integration. Demand grows alongside miniaturization and surface-sensitive materials.
Paper/Tissue-Backed
Paper/tissue options are cost-efficient for lightweight bonding, mounting, and temporary fixations. They suit printing, packaging, and crafts where smooth tear and easy disposal matter. Suppliers improve moisture tolerance for wider utility in semi-industrial setups.
Unsupported/Transfer-Backed
Transfer tapes offer invisible bonds and excellent alignment in high-fidelity laminations. They integrate into aerospace, displays, and protective films requiring minimal weight and high clarity. Clean release liners and strong shear properties enhance production efficiency.
Others
Other materials, including specialized composites, serve niche bonding uses where strength, weight reduction, or chemical resistance is key. Vendors co-develop these with OEMs to support new materials adoption and differentiated aesthetics.
Double Sided Tape Market, Segmentation by End-Use Industry
This axis reflects diverse bonding needs across mobility, infrastructure, electronics, and industrial segments. Manufacturers align with OEMs to replace mechanical fasteners, reduce assembly weight, and boost reliability. Custom die-cuts, automation compatibility, and improved environmental resistance shape purchasing preference.
Automotive
In automotive, tapes enable lightweight bonding, noise reduction, and streamlined assembly for trims, sensors, and interior parts. Electrification trends increase demand for thermal and vibration-resistant adhesives that support EV design requirements. Suppliers partner closely with Tier-1s to meet life-cycle reliability standards.
Building & Construction
Construction applications rely on weatherproof adhesion, insulation bonding, and façade installations where drilling is restricted. The shift toward modern methods of construction increases the role of high-strength tapes in maintaining envelope performance. Sustainability certifications favor low-VOC options that enhance indoor safety.
Electrical & Electronics
The electronics segment demands precision, heat tolerance, and clean bonding for miniaturized components. Tapes support displays, wearables, and battery modules with thin-gauge constructions. As devices become slimmer, high bonding strength without mechanical intrusion drives material upgrades.
Paper & Printing
Paper and printing industries use tapes for splicing, mounting, and holding in high-speed production lines. Reliable initial tack and clean removal ensure productivity and substrate protection. Cost-effective solutions with consistent quality drive competitiveness in this segment.
Others
Additional end-uses span general industry, healthcare, and consumer goods requiring specialized adhesion performance. Ease of custom cutting and rapid design changes support pilot runs and growth in customized production environments.

Development in automotive industry - Opening new opportunities for adhesive manufacturers worldwide. As vehicle manufacturers shift toward lightweight materials to improve fuel efficiency and meet emission norms, adhesives are increasingly replacing bolts, rivets, and welds to bond composite and hybrid structures.
Electric vehicles (EVs) in particular demand advanced bonding solutions for battery assemblies, thermal management systems, and lightweight enclosures. These applications require adhesives that offer thermal stability, chemical resistance, and electrical insulation, further pushing innovation in the market. The demand for noise, vibration, and harshness (NVH) reduction has also increased reliance on adhesives in automotive interiors.
With a growing focus on vehicle safety and structural integrity, adhesives now play a key role in crash performance by providing energy absorption and impact resistance. Regulatory trends such as Euro 7 standards and zero-emission vehicle targets are reinforcing the adoption of advanced materials and bonding technologies.
As the industry moves toward modular vehicle platforms, smart manufacturing, and increased automation, adhesives are expected to be central to design innovation, providing manufacturers with flexibility, efficiency, and product differentiation.
